Arranging Your Ideal Trip: Cancun's Cyclic Weather Patterns
Cancun, a tropical paradise in Mexico, boasts stunning weather throughout the year. Nevertheless, understanding Cancun's seasonal weather trends can help you plan your perfect trip for maximum sunshine. The high season, from December to April, brings warm temperatures and scarce rain, making it perfect for swimming.
- On the other hand, the off-seasons, May to June and September to November, offer a more peaceful atmosphere with warm weather and lower prices.
- In the wet season, from July to August, be prepared for frequent showers. Though it could disrupt your outdoor schedule, these brief showers are often accompanied by sunshine.
No matter when you decide to visit Cancun, remember to pack for both sunshine and showers. With a little preparation, your trip to this stunning destination will be unforgettable.

What's the Weather Like in Cancun? A Packing Guide
When gathering for your Cancun getaway, understanding the weather is crucial. Cancun boasts a tropical climate with warm temperatures year-round. Expect sunny skies and gentle breezes during the day, while evenings often turn breezy. Remember to pack lightweight clothing, swimwear, and comfortable shoes for exploring the beaches. A light jacket or sweater is recommended for cooler evenings or air-conditioned spaces. Don't forget sun protection as the sun can be quite intense in Cancun.
- Pack light, breathable clothing items such as shorts, t-shirts, and sundresses.
- If you plan on swimming or snorkeling, pack appropriate attire.
- Layer your clothing to adjust to varying temperatures throughout the day.
